Wilton is located in the region of Northern Territory. Northern Territory's capital Darwin (Darwin) is approximately 493 km / 306 mi away from Wilton (as the crow flies). The distance from Wilton to Australia's capital Canberra (Canberra) is approximately 2,715 km / 1,687 mi (as the crow flies).
